1.nw.js下載地址:https://nwjs.org.cn/

2.新建組態檔package.json,放于根目錄下
{
"name":"DDmSc", //這里的name屬性很重要,類似唯一標示,不可少!
"main":"Power BI 檔案 - Power BI Microsoft Docs.htm", //視窗要渲染的檔案
"nodejs":true, //true,為啟用nodejs
"description":"Power BI 檔案 - Power BI Microsoft Docs",
"node-main":"app.js", //nodejs的入口檔案
"single-instance":true,//單例運行,節約占用記憶體空間
"chromium-args":"--disable-gpu",//谷歌瀏覽器啟動默認關閉GPU渲染
"chromium-args":"--disable-cookie-encryption",//禁止cookie加密存盤到磁盤中
"window":{
"show":"true",
"icon": "img5.png",
"width":1566,
"height":883,
"position":"center",//螢屏居中展示
"resizable":false,//不允許拖動大小
"title": "Power BI 檔案 - Power BI Microsoft Docs"//無效,解決方案:默認是home頁title屬性值
}
}
PS:其他的詳細配置,請移步到官方檔案查閱:https://nwjs.readthedocs.io/en/latest/
3.示例:
例如我想把Power BI 官方檔案打包為自己的桌面小程式
將專案檔案放置在nw.js原始碼包路徑下

4.雙擊啟動即可,

5.使用Enigma Virtual Box打包外殼(會增加啟動耗時),百度搜索下載安裝即可

6.安裝完畢以后啟動,默認是英文可以選擇-language選擇Chinese,然后關閉程式,重啟程式即為中文版本



打包后的檔案,圖示以及詳細資訊版本資訊可以下載其他工具替換即可


這種會影響到啟動耗時,但是是綠色直接啟動的,洗掉此exe磁盤不會保留任何檔案,除了h5快取的資訊,
另外一種方法就是將web專案打包成安裝包
以下為打包成安裝包步驟:
下載安裝:Inno Setup 編譯器

點擊構建編譯即可,
轉載請註明出處,本文鏈接:https://www.uj5u.com/qiye/183869.html
標籤:其他
上一篇:a標簽跳轉referer漏洞
